Therapeutic Approaches and Online Options

Linda integrates Cognitive Behavioral Therapy and Acceptance and Commitment Therapy alongside client-centered and mindfulness-informed strategies. CBT focuses on identifying and changing unhelpful thoughts and behaviors to reduce symptoms and build coping skills, often useful for anxiety, depression, and sleep issues. ACT encourages acceptance of difficult internal experiences while clarifying personal values and committing to actions that align with those values, which can help with life transitions, grief, and managing distress.
